How AI is Shaping Modern Military Intelligence Operations
The integration of artificial intelligence (AI) into military intelligence operations is revolutionizing how nations approach defense, security, and information gathering. As the complexity of global conflicts escalates, AI technologies provide unprecedented advantages in data analysis, predictive modeling, and operational efficiency.
One of the most significant contributions of AI in military intelligence is its ability to process vast amounts of data quickly. Traditional intelligence gathering methods often involve labor-intensive analysis of reports, satellite imagery, and other forms of information. AI streamlines this process by utilizing machine learning algorithms to sift through mountains of data, identifying patterns and anomalies that human analysts might miss.
For example, AI systems can analyze satellite imagery to detect changes in infrastructure or troop movements, providing real-time insights that enhance situational awareness. This capability not only speeds up the intelligence cycle but also improves decision-making effectiveness for military leaders, allowing them to respond swiftly to emerging threats.
Additionally, AI enhances predictive analytics, enabling military strategists to forecast potential conflict zones and assess threats before they materialize. By analyzing historical data and current trends, AI can identify indicators of instability or aggression, allowing military planners to allocate resources more effectively and formulate proactive strategies.
Cybersecurity is another critical domain where AI is making a significant impact on military intelligence operations. With the increasing frequency of cyber threats, AI-driven tools are being deployed to monitor networks for suspicious activities and identify vulnerabilities. This proactive approach to cybersecurity helps safeguard sensitive military information and maintain operational readiness in the face of cyber warfare.
Moreover, the use of AI in intelligence operations fosters collaboration between different military branches and allied nations. Through platforms that utilize AI to share and analyze intelligence, forces can achieve a more unified understanding of global security challenges. This collaborative effort not only enhances situational awareness but also strengthens international partnerships in defense.
However, the increasing reliance on AI technologies also raises ethical considerations and challenges. Issues such as data privacy, bias in algorithms, and the potential for autonomous weapons systems need to be addressed comprehensively. Military organizations must ensure that AI implementations are governed by strict ethical standards and regulations to prevent misuse and uphold accountability.
